Update Vorgehensweise

Tim Herbst 2021-01-18 18:52:20 +00:00
parent 983bbf36ad
commit 9101d8faf8

@ -384,21 +384,21 @@ export const environment = {
```
Somit ergibt sich dann bei einem Aufruf mit einem HTTP-GET folgende Architektur der URL:
```
public exampleMethod(param: string): Promise<any> {
return this.client.get(environment.apiUrl + `urlToEndpoint/${param}/`).toPromise();
}
public exampleMethod(param: string): Promise<any> {
return this.client.get(environment.apiUrl + `urlToEndpoint/${param}/`).toPromise();
}
```
#### Beispiel aus dem DashboardService
```
public fetchDashboardInit(id: string): Promise<any> {
return this.client.get(environment.apiUrl + `latest/dashboard/${id}/`).toPromise();
}
public fetchDashboardInit(id: string): Promise<any> {
return this.client.get(environment.apiUrl + `latest/dashboard/${id}/`).toPromise();
}
```
#### Beispiel aus dem MapService
```
private fetchBikePointGeoData(): Promise<any> {
return this.client.get(environment.apiUrl + 'latest/bikepoints/').toPromise();
}
private fetchBikePointGeoData(): Promise<any> {
return this.client.get(environment.apiUrl + 'latest/bikepoints/').toPromise();
}
```
Weitere Beispiele sind aus dem Sourcecode zu entnehmen.